New York State Teachers Retirement System Has $5.10 Million Holdings in Tanger Inc. $SKT

New York State Teachers Retirement System cut its stake in Tanger Inc. (NYSE:SKTFree Report) by 12.6% in the fourth quarter, according to the company in its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The firm owned 152,768 shares of the real estate investment trust’s stock after selling 21,929 shares during the period. New York State Teachers Retirement System’s holdings in Tanger were worth $5,098,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ission.

Tanger (NYSE:SKTG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, April 30th. The real estate investment trust reported $0.24 EPS for the quarter, missing anal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.28 by ($0.04). Tanger had a return on equity of 17.53% and a net margin of 20.76%.The business had revenue of $150.42 million for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$142.94 million. During the same quarter in the prior year, the company earned $0.53 earnings per share. The company’s quarterly revenue was up 11.1% on a year-over-year basis. Tanger has set its FY 2026 guidance at 2.420-2.500 EPS. On average, equities analysts expect that Tanger Inc. will post 2.46 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Tanger Increases Dividend

The company also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Friday, May 15th. Stockholders of record on Thursday, April 30th will be paid a dividend of $0.3125 per share. The ex-dividend date is Thursday, April 30th. This represents a $1.25 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 3.4%. This is a boost from Tanger’s previous quarterly dividend of $0.29. Tanger’s dividend payout ratio (DPR) is presently 116.82%.

About Tanger

(Free Report)

Tanger Factory Outlet Centers, Inc (NYSE: SKT) is a real estate investment trust specializing in the ownership, development and management of outlet shopping centers. The company’s portfolio comprises more than 40 outlet properties anchored by leading fashion and lifestyle brands. Tanger’s centers are designed to offer off-price retail experiences in open-air, community-oriented settings, providing value-focused shoppers with access to premium brands at reduced prices.
